My first time being in South Carolina my brother who had previously moved to Colleton county decided to take me out to Jacksonboro. We turned onto the road and turned around at the church and then decided to park and get out. Having flashed our lights beforehand we walked down the road a few feet and almost as soon as we stopped walking we heard the train. The light appeared and it was white first. We began agitating it. We realized that the light turns red when it is angry. It charged after us. I couldn't move. I couldn't run. I could barely breathe. It was around 500 ft in front of me when it disappeared and I could move again.
